OverviewA career as a doctor can take many different forms. Whether diagnosing diseases, performing life-saving surgery or fighting a pandemic, doctors do all kinds of amazing jobs. Join them at work in air ambulances, operating theatres, on home visits and in hospitals - then find out how YOU could become a doctor yourself.
